On Thursday, MLB Pipeline published their Top 30 prospects lists for the American League East, with reporter Jonathan Mayo having plenty of encouraging things to say about a vastly improved Baltimore Orioles farm system. With four players in the Top 100 overall and a majority of the Top 30 set to debut in the next two seasons, Mayo says that “the rebuilding effort is moving very much in a positive direction”.
Those top four players are no surprise to fans who pay attention to prospect lists, with generational catching talent Adley Rutschman fourth overall, followed by right-hander Grayson Rodriguez at #36, lefty DL Hall at #69, and first baseball Ryan Mountcastle squeezing in at #94.
